Virginia Murder Suspect Captured in Augusta Hotel After Dramatic Escape Attempt

A multi-agency law enforcement operation in Augusta, Georgia led to the capture of a Virginia murder suspect on Friday afternoon. The suspect, identified as Prince Moore, 41, was wanted in connection with the fatal shooting of 22-year-old Tyron R. Clanton in Petersburg, Virginia. Authorities located Moore hiding at the Travelodge Hotel, situated at 3039 Washington Road in Augusta, where the dramatic arrest unfolded shortly after 3:30 p.m.

Location and Circumstances of the Arrest

According to the Richmond County Sheriff’s Office, deputies and members of the U.S. Marshals Service coordinated to track down and apprehend Moore, who had been on the run for several days following a deadly shooting in Virginia. At approximately 3:36 p.m. on Friday, officers converged on the hotel after receiving intelligence that Moore was using a false name to check into a second-floor room.

As law enforcement approached, Moore reportedly realized he had been discovered. In a desperate attempt to flee, he jumped from the second-floor window of the hotel. Witnesses described hearing a loud thud as the suspect landed on the pavement below. Despite the fall, Moore tried to continue his escape on foot, but he was swiftly surrounded and detained by pursuing officers within moments.

Authorities said Moore sustained minor injuries from the fall but was treated at the scene before being taken into custody without further incident. Following the arrest, the area around the Travelodge was briefly secured while officers searched the suspect’s room for evidence.

Victims and Crime Details

The murder case that led to Moore’s capture stems from the shooting death of Tyron R. Clanton, a 22-year-old resident of Petersburg, Virginia, who was found fatally wounded near a gas station earlier this year. Investigators in Virginia reported that the incident occurred after an altercation escalated into gunfire. Clanton, who had been shot multiple times, was pronounced dead at the scene before emergency responders could transport him to a nearby hospital.

Family and friends described Tyron Clanton as a bright, hardworking young man with dreams of pursuing a career in business. He was known in his community for his kindness and ambition. Clanton’s family, devastated by his loss, had been calling for justice since the shooting occurred. The news of Moore’s arrest has reportedly brought them a measure of relief after months of uncertainty.

Law Enforcement Response

Officials confirmed that Moore will face extradition proceedings to return to Virginia, where he will be formally charged with first-degree murder and related firearm offenses. Richmond County Sheriff’s Office representatives commended the cooperation between local authorities and federal agencies in bringing the fugitive to justice.

Sheriff’s deputies noted that the U.S. Marshals Service played a crucial role in tracking Moore’s movements across state lines, ultimately leading to the discovery of his location in Augusta. The operation was described as “precise and well-coordinated,” ensuring the safety of both the officers and the public during the high-risk arrest.
